Psychiatry is the medical field that is focused on diagnosing, treating and preventing mental health issues. Unlike other mental healthcare professionals such as counsellors and psychologists who are trained in medical science, psychiatrists have decided to specialize in this field. They can prescribe medication and suggest other treatments. Psychiatrists work in a variety of locations, including hospitals wards and outpatient clinics. 2. Consultation

After your referral has been received, a face-to-face or online video consultation will be conducted with the consultant psychiatrist. They will assess your condition and medical history, and provide you with a likely diagnosis. They will then formulate specific treatment recommendations for your mental health and well-being that are based on the holistic biopsychosocial model of care. They can also prepare an assessment to your GP if required.
